if your system still boots to a terminal you just have to pkg update dkms drm.
if you got a reboot loop as it happened to me then you need a usb boot pen drive with live freebsd, mount the filesystem and edit rc.conf and boot loader to disable the drivers, then boot and update dkms drm.
